CVE-2026-27622
OpenEXR CompositeDeepScanLine integer-overflow leads to heap OOB write
Description

OpenEXR provides the specification and reference implementation of the EXR file format, an image storage format for the motion picture industry. In CompositeDeepScanLine::readPixels, per-pixel totals are accumulated in vector<unsigned int> total_sizes for attacker-controlled large counts across many parts, total_sizes[ptr] wraps modulo 2^32. overall_sample_count is then derived from wrapped totals and used in samples[channel].resize(overall_sample_count). Decode pointer setup/consumption proceeds with true sample counts, and write operations in core unpack (generic_unpack_deep_pointers) overrun the undersized composite sample buffer. This vulnerability is fixed in v3.2.6, v3.3.8, and v3.4.6.

Solution
Update OpenEXR to a patched version to prevent buffer overflows from malformed image files.
  • Update OpenEXR to version v3.2.6 or later.
  • Apply security patches provided by the vendor.
  • Validate image file integrity before processing.
  • Limit processing of untrusted image files.
